The Importance of Fitness in Surfing
Surfing demands a unique set of physical attributes. Paddling out, catching waves, and maintaining control on the board necessitate core strength, upper body endurance, flexibility, and balance. Traditional surfing training often focused on simply riding waves, but surfit shifts the emphasis to cross-training and physical preparation. Here are some components that make fitness integral to surfing:
Core Strength
- Why it Matters: Core strength is essential for maintaining balance and control. A strong core stabilizes the body on the board, making it easier to shift weight and stay upright.
- Exercises to Try: Planks, Russian twists, and stability ball workouts are excellent choices for enhancing core stability.
Upper Body Endurance
- Why it Matters: Paddling takes significant upper body strength, especially in the shoulders, arms, and back.
- Exercises to Try: Resistance band workouts, push-ups, and swim-specific exercises can improve endurance and strength.
Flexibility
- Why it Matters: Flexibility helps surfers maneuver movements smoothly and maintain balance.
- Exercises to Try: Yoga sessions focusing on hip openers and spinal flexibility can be particularly beneficial.
Incorporating Surfit into Your Routine
Integrating surfit into your training program does not have to be overwhelming. Here are some tips for getting started:
1. Create a Balanced Workout Plan
A well-rounded workout plan should include strength training, cardio, and flexibility exercises. Aim to allocate specific days for each discipline to ensure comprehensive training.
2. Cross-Training
Engage in activities such as swimming, yoga, or even martial arts to develop agility and flexibility. These activities complement surfing by strengthening different muscle groups and improving overall fitness.
3. Use Technology
With fitness apps and wearable technology, you can track your performance, monitor heart rates, and evaluate your progress. This data can provide insights into your training efficiency and areas for improvement.
Mental Aspect of Surfit
Surfit isn’t merely about physical training; the mental component is equally vital. Surfing demands focus and calmness amidst the chaotic waves. Here are some mental training strategies:
Visualization Techniques
Visualization can significantly improve your surfing skills. Spend time imagining yourself successfully riding different waves, and practice your form in your mind.
Mindfulness and Breathing Exercises
Practicing mindfulness can enhance your awareness of both your body and the environment. Deep breathing techniques can help manage anxiety and improve concentration when you’re out in the water.
